Under general supervision of the Nurse Manager, the registered nurse uses the nursing process to safely coordinate total patient care and education for an assigned number of patients. Assignments to units are determined by patient census and current staffing levels, and reviewed on a shift-to-shift basis. The nurse will be assigned up to 40 hours per week and will rotate between day and night shifts as needed by the unit and staff. The nurse is expected to function within the scope of approved policies, procedures, and regulations for the department and organization. The nurse will assist with orientation, preceptorship, and management of personnel assigned to the unit. Must be able to work professionally with peers, physicians, administration, patients, and visitors. The nurse will document total care provided, review and maintain patient charts per policy, and assist with accurate and timely entry of patient data, orders, and charges into the computer system. The successful candidate will have to pass a pharmacology test for this position. Attendance at yearly mandatory education requirements is nonnegotiable and will be the responsibility of the employee to arrange and attend sessions. The RN will also work under the general supervision of the Ambulance Dept Head, using the Pre-Hospital and ACLS Process.
